Whittaker means "white field,” which seems rather lackluster particularly if your other children have names with strong meanings. Benjamin’s meaning of “son of my right hand” (which designates high favor) is much more evocative. Benjamin Whittaker has a nice flow.Here are some other names with repeat letters and their meanings:
Cassian- uncertain origin perhaps from "protective cover"
Atticus- "shore"
Steffan- "crown"
Emmett- "whole" or "universal"
Phillip- "friend of horses"
Allen- "handsome"
William- "will protect"
Wyatt- "brave battle"
Elliot- "the Lord is my God"
Wallace- "foreigner"
Warren- "general; warden"
Matthew- "gift of God"
Brennan- "son of water"
Jesse- "gift"
Kenneth- "handsome"
Bennett- "blessed"
